Smart Places to Use Car Clipart

Clipart shines when clarity beats realism. Social posts need instant recognition, so a bold silhouette with one accent color is perfect. Pitch decks love iconography—use a simple car to represent logistics, rideshare, or emissions topics without implying a specific brand. Teachers can turn worksheets into mini-worlds: traffic-safety games, counting activities, or science diagrams with different vehicle types. Small businesses can highlight services—detailing, towing, rental—using consistent car icons across flyers, web headers, and price boards.

Licensing, Attribution, and Ethics

Before you hit download, check the license. “Free” doesn’t always mean free for commercial use. Look for terms like personal vs. commercial, attribution required, and redistribution rules. Royalty-free usually means one-time payment for broad use; rights-managed restricts usage by geography or duration. Avoid clipart that resembles trademarked designs or includes car logos—trade dress can get murky. If you’re unsure, choose generic shapes that evoke a type (hatchback, SUV, classic coupe) without specific brand cues.

Posture And Breath Reset

Before you shift into drive, take 30 seconds to set your position. Sit tall on your sit bones, not rolled back on your tailbone. Slide your hips back in the seat, feet flat, and imagine a string gently lifting the crown of your head. Let your ribs soften down so your lower back is neutral, not arched or slumped. Adjust your mirrors for this posture; if you begin to slouch, the mirrors will cue you to reset. Lightly draw your shoulder blades down and back, then let them rest without tension.

Why Car Lights Matter More Than You Think

Car lights are easy to take for granted until the night gets really dark, the rain goes sideways, or a deer appears at the edge of your lane. They’re not just there so you can see; they’re how you communicate on the road. Headlights show your path, brake lights warn the person behind you, indicators negotiate space, and reverse lights signal intention. In fog, on wet roads, and during those tricky dawn and dusk hours, good lighting and smart habits shrink the unknowns. The kicker is that visibility is rarely symmetric: your eyes may be fresh while someone else’s are tired; your SUV headlights sit higher than the compact in front; your daytime running lights might look bright from the front but leave your rear dark at twilight. That’s why a few simple habits go a long way. Keep your lenses clean, turn on full headlights whenever visibility drops, and check your bulbs periodically. Skip tinted lamp covers and overly blue bulbs; they might look cool but they cost you usable light and can blind others. Good lighting is shared safety.

Headlights 101: Halogen, HID, LED, and Laser

Not all headlights are created equal. Halogens are the old faithful: cheap, warm-colored, and easy to replace, but they’re dimmer and burn out sooner. HIDs (xenon) are brighter and more efficient than halogen with a crisp color, though they need a moment to warm up and can produce harsh glare if put in the wrong housing. LEDs changed the game with instant full brightness, long life, and flexible shapes for designers. They sip power compared to halogens and maintain output well, but heat management and quality matter a lot—cheap drop-in LED bulbs can scatter light everywhere. Laser headlights, despite the sci-fi name, don’t shine lasers on the road; they excite a phosphor to create very bright, focused light for long-range high beams. They’re rare and pricey. More important than the bulb tech is the beam pattern and optic (reflector vs. projector). A well-aimed, well-designed halogen can beat a poorly executed LED. Color temperature also matters: very blue light can look bright but reflect more glare in rain and fog.

Build a Preventive Plan So Emergencies Don’t Choose for You

The easiest way to “find a car repair shop near me” is to already have one before something breaks. Start with a baseline inspection: brakes, fluids, tires, battery health, filters, and suspension. Ask for a maintenance roadmap that aligns with your mileage and driving style. Schedule future items now, set reminders, and keep digital records. Familiarity reduces diagnostic time and helps your shop spot patterns early, like a slow battery or a small coolant seep that could become a tow later.

What “Car Repair Shop Near Me” Really Means

When most of us type “car repair shop near me,” we’re not just hunting for the closest garage. We’re looking for a place that will treat our car (and our time) with respect. Proximity is convenient, sure, but the best match is often a shop that balances location with skill, transparency, and turnaround. If a place an extra five minutes away consistently fixes things right the first time, communicates clearly, and stands behind the work, that’s real convenience.
